Is Steam down every Tuesday?
Basic routine maintenance on Steam servers is performed on Tuesdays, with some outages occurring generally around the afternoon to evening times — around 1-3 p.m. Pacific time, more or less.

How long does Steam usually go down for?
It’s important to remember that Steam is a global service, so there are always users online. Our peak user load is around noon at our local time, and our lowest user count is around 2300 local time. When we have planned downtime, it usually lasts less than an hour.

How long is Steam down on Tuesdays?
Steam routine maintenance starts at 7 PM EST or 4 PM PT (more or less) on Tuesdays and usually takes 5 to 10 minutes to complete. Keep in mind that some service issues may sometimes occur shortly after maintenance.

What if I get the message “The Steam servers are currently down for routine maintenance.” but it isn’t Tuesday? This is a message that the Steam client gives whenever it can connect to the internet but can’t connect to Steam’s servers.
Why does steam say it is down for maintenance?
This is a message that the Steam client gives whenever it can connect to the internet but can’t connect to Steam’s servers. It doesn’t mean there is currently routine maintenance being performed.
